2x+y=35...............(1)

3x+4y=65...............(2)

Multiplying equation (1) by 4 we get,

8x+4y=140...................(3)

Subtracting equation (2) from (3) we get,

5x=75

x=75/5

x=15

Substituting the value of x in equation (1)

2(15) +y=35....... (1)

30+y=35

y=35-30

y=5

So, (15, 5) are the roots of given linear equation in two variable.
